The Nokia BB5 Code USB Sender is a legacy utility from the mid-to-late 2000s used to interact with Nokia's "Baseband 5" (BB5) generation of mobile phones. These devices, which include iconic models like the Nokia N70, N95, and 6630, featured advanced security that typically required specialized hardware or "logs" for unlocking and servicing. Core Purpose and Functionality

The specific .exe file (often identified in versions like 2.4.8) serves as a bridge between a PC and a Nokia handset connected via USB. Its primary functions include:

Reading Phone Logs: Extracting encrypted "hash" or log files from the device. These logs were historically sent to remote servers or run through local calculators (like BB5_calc.exe) to generate network unlock codes.

Sending Unlock Codes: Automatically transmitting the generated 15-digit codes (Master Codes or NCK codes) to the phone to remove SIM restrictions.

Counter Reseting: Clearing the "Key Code Count" if a user has entered the wrong unlock code too many times, which normally "hard-locks" the device. nokia bb5 code usb sender exe 248

Service Tasks: Reading user-set security codes (PINs) if they have been forgotten, without wiping user data. Operational Requirements

To use this software effectively, a specific hardware environment is required:

Connection: A compatible USB cable (like the CA-53 or DKU-2).

Drivers: Pre-installed Nokia Connectivity Cable Drivers or the full Nokia PC/OVI Suite to ensure the PC recognizes the handset in "PC Suite" or "Local" mode.

Environment: These legacy tools often require older operating systems like Windows XP or Windows 7 (run in compatibility mode) to function correctly. Important Historical Context

Most modern users will find this tool obsolete for two reasons:

Server Dependency: Many versions of these "senders" relied on external servers to process logs. As the BB5 era ended, these servers were shut down, making the "Read/Send" process impossible for many SL3 (Service Level 3) devices.

Security Risks: As an unverified legacy executable (.exe), these files are frequently flagged by modern antivirus software as "Potentially Unwanted Programs" (PUPs) or malware due to their nature as cracking/unlocking utilities.

Note: If you are trying to unlock a modern Nokia (HMD Global) device, this software will not work, as modern Android-based Nokias do not use the BB5 security architecture.

Here’s why such files are problematic:

  1. Potential Malware – Executable files (.exe) from unofficial sources claiming to unlock phones often contain trojans, keyloggers, or ransomware. “BB5 code USB sender” tools are commonly repackaged with malware.

  2. Circumvention of Security – BB5 is a security architecture used in older Nokia phones (e.g., Nokia 6300, N95, 3120 classic). Software that claims to generate or send unlock codes via USB is typically used to bypass network locks or repair IMEI-related functions, which may violate laws in many jurisdictions.

  3. No Official Tool – Nokia never released such an executable. Legitimate unlocking requires authorized service tools (e.g., some versions of Phoenix Service Software or ATF boxes) — not a standalone .exe that sends codes via USB.

  4. Typo/Naming Clues – “248” could refer to a file size (248 KB) or a version number. Small, unsigned executables in this niche are very frequently malicious.

The phrase "Nokia BB5 code USB sender exe 248" typically refers to a legacy software utility used for recovering forgotten security or lock codes from Nokia BB5 (Baseband 5) generation mobile phones. Overview of BB5 Code Recovery

During the mid-to-late 2000s, Nokia BB5 devices (like the N73, N95, and 6300) were widely used. If a user forgot their security code, specialized tools like the "USB Sender" were employed to extract the code from the phone's internal memory via a USB connection.

Default Code: For most original Nokia devices, the factory default security code is 12345.

Alternative Method: You can attempt to reset the device to factory settings (which may reset the code) by entering *#7370# on the home screen, though this will erase all user data. Technical Details & Safety

3.1 Primary Functionality

The "USB Sender" utility was designed to bypass the need for expensive hardware boxes in certain unlocking scenarios. Its typical workflow involved:

  1. Connection: Establishing a connection with the Nokia phone via a standard USB cable (DKU-2 or CA-53).
  2. Mode Switch: Putting the phone into a specific technical mode (often "Local Mode" or "Test Mode") using a modified operating system or a "kill script."
  3. Interaction: Communicating with the phone's RAP3G processor to read lock data or write unlocking codes (NCK codes) directly to the device memory.
